What should be checked first on a skeletal trailer at delivery?

Start with a full visual walkaround before any detailed measurement or road-related check.

Look for transport damage, frame distortion, missing parts, loose fasteners, paint damage, and signs of rushed assembly.

The skeletal trailer frame should sit level on flat ground. Uneven stance may indicate suspension misalignment or chassis twist.

Check whether the VIN plate, manufacturer identification, axle markings, and rated load labels are present and readable.

Delivery should also include spare accessories, tool kits, and any promised options listed in the order confirmation.

Initial acceptance checklist

  • Check overall appearance and transport damage
  • Confirm model, axle count, and load rating
  • Verify parts against packing and specification list
  • Inspect landing gear, king pin, and tires
  • Review certificates and service documents

How do you inspect structural integrity and weld quality?

Structural inspection is the most important part of skeletal trailer delivery acceptance.

Focus on the main beam, cross members, gooseneck area, rear structure, and container support sections.

Welds should appear continuous, clean, and consistent. Watch for undercutting, porosity, cracks, excessive spatter, or uneven penetration.

Pay close attention to stress concentration zones near suspension hangers, landing gear brackets, and twist-lock mounting points.

If the unit uses Q345B carbon steel or similar high-strength material, verify that material declarations match the supplied specification.

For example, some export models use a 500mm beam height with thicker upper, middle, and lower plates for heavy container duty.

Any visible repair welding should be documented. Unrecorded repair points deserve immediate clarification before acceptance.

Which dimensions and container locking points matter most?

Dimensional accuracy directly affects loading efficiency, container fit, and legal road operation.

Measure overall length, width, deck alignment, king pin position, axle spacing, and rear overhang against approved drawings.

A skeletal trailer designed for 20ft and 40ft containers must position locks exactly for secure engagement.

Inspect all twist-locks for smooth operation, full rotation, secure retention, and correct installation angle.

If the trailer includes 8 to 12 container locks, test every point rather than assuming identical performance.

Dimensional errors may not look dramatic, but they often cause loading refusal at ports and intermodal yards.

Common dimensional risk points

  • Misplaced twist-lock bases
  • Uneven cross member spacing
  • Incorrect king pin setting
  • Axle alignment outside tolerance
  • Landing gear interference during turning

What mechanical and safety systems must be tested?

Do not limit skeletal trailer acceptance to static inspection. Functional systems must also be checked.

Inspect the brake system, air lines, chambers, valves, electrical harness, lights, reflectors, suspension, and tires.

If fitted with WABCO valves, verify hose routing, leak-free connections, and normal response during brake application tests.

Six large air chambers should be securely mounted, free from dents, and matched with correct brake hardware.

Check tire size against specification, such as 12R22.5, and confirm date codes, pressure, and wheel nut torque.

Landing gear should raise and lower smoothly. A 28T JOST-type system must hold load without abnormal vibration or slipping.

For engineering machinery transport support work, lighting and braking reliability are essential on highways and site access roads.

How can coating, corrosion protection, and finish quality affect service life?

Surface quality is not only cosmetic. It strongly affects durability in ports, wet yards, and coastal routes.

Check whether the chassis was properly sandblasted before painting and whether coverage is uniform around hidden edges.

Look beneath the frame, around weld seams, and inside brackets for thin paint, overspray, bubbling, or early rust spots.

A skeletal trailer working in global shipping and logistics conditions needs strong anticorrosive protection from the start.

Custom color and logo quality should also be reviewed if branding consistency matters for fleet presentation.

Which documents and certifications should accompany a skeletal trailer delivery?

Documentation proves the skeletal trailer matches order requirements and applicable standards.

Request the inspection report, packing list, certificate copies, warranty terms, axle information, and parts manual.

If relevant to the project, confirm BV, ISO, or CCC records and ensure serial numbers match the delivered unit.

The warranty period, after-sales response path, and spare parts support should be understood before the trailer enters service.

FAQ inspection summary table

Inspection areaWhat to verifyWhy it matters
Frame and weldsCracks, porosity, alignment, repair marksPrevents structural failure
DimensionsLength, width, axle spacing, king pinEnsures legal and practical operation
Container locksPosition, rotation, retention strengthSecures container safely
Brake and tiresAir leaks, chamber mounting, tire conditionReduces road safety risk
DocumentsCertificates, warranty, manuals, serial matchSupports compliance and service

A skeletal trailer should never be accepted based only on appearance or delivery urgency.

Use a structured checklist, confirm technical details, and document every finding with photos and written sign-off notes.
